Output 3209291f36f23c7af61b0f8e2799c55a921a18920ea94167c7aba12c47f5ad09:0

value
151042
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37e4307006005e6fb31487c02cc8e69741de755f OP_EQUALVERIFY OP_CHECKSIG
address
166XXR4hXZ8JqTWdevGGBATrXrv5uMAoHF
transaction
3209291f36f23c7af61b0f8e2799c55a921a18920ea94167c7aba12c47f5ad09
confirmations
571250
spent
true